Bautista ends his test with the MotoGP: “My future is SBK”

alvaro bautista has completed its second test day this Wednesday with the Ducati Desmosedici MotoGP. If the first day was dedicated to recovering feelings about the prototype of Borgo Panigale, which had not been climbed since 2018 in Valencia, the second session was used, according to his team, “to ride continuously, dedicating himself to the set-up and also testing different tire solutions”. He completed 49 laps of the circuit Misano, with the best time of 1:32.590 registered in the seventh lap of the fourth race with soft tires and 49° track temperature.

The time is anecdotal, but to put it in context, with that lap he would have qualified tenth on the grid in the GP of San Marino e della Riviera di Rimini 2022. Pole position on that occasion went to the Jack Miller’s Ducatiwhich stopped the clock at 1:31.899. (0.691 faster than Spanish). “Time? It’s not important either because I never pushed for the time trial: there was no reason to take risks”, confirms the Spanish pilot, who then assessed his feelings after the two days of testing: “It has been a good test. I really enjoyed getting back on the Ducati Desmosedici GP and I am satisfied with the work we have done. In addition, between the first and the second day, the sensations also improved thanks to the team, since Ducati put me in a position to fix the bike with modifications that helped me feel even more comfortable. We also worked to gain confidence with different tire solutions and the results were tangible.”

And with the possibility of wild card in MotoGP in the air, the man from Talavera stands out and focuses on the immediate: “The future? The future is in Donington and Imola. We have two very close rounds and after this good experience I only have to think about the WorldSBK championship”. And proof of this is that after completing the test with the Desmosedici, Bautista spent the afternoon shooting with his usual mount, the Panigale V4R the motorcycle with which he dominates the World Superbike firmly and with which he will run in Donington (UK) the weekend of June 29 to July 2.
